Revealing Exactness: A Handbook to 5-Axis CNC Mills

Understanding 5-axis CNC machines can seem intimidating at the initial glance, but they’re reshaping manufacturing across multiple industries. Different from traditional 3-axis machines, a 5-axis mill offers the ability to move the item in five separate directions, facilitating highly complex shapes and reducing the need for numerous setups. This increased flexibility contributes to improved exactness, faster lead times, and a expanded range of creative options.

CNC Router 5-Axis Technology: Upsides and Uses

Cutting-edge 5-axis CNC router machines represent a substantial leap in production capabilities. Unlike traditional 3-axis routers, these tools enable for detailed parts to be created in a single setup, reducing machine time and increasing general output. Common applications cover aviation components, automotive molds, clinical devices, building prototypes, and custom furniture.
